Description of ๐Ÿ”ฅ Dr. Ph. Martin's Iridescent Calligraphy Color Ink Bottle, Copper Plate Gold (11R)

Copper plate gold (11r) in a 1.0 oz glass bottle with dropper. Stunning colors with a pearl shimmer and shine and unmatched color intensity. Lightfast, waterproof, archival grade color made from the finest ground pigments. 24 Unique colors available across two different sets. Made in the USA. Designed For Use With : Brush, Air Brush, Dip Pen

EXCELLENT gold ink on art supplies

I LOVE this gold ink! Some gold ink is too thin and barely visible on light colored surfaces. Some of them are too thick and take a long time to dry. Some are too yellow with almost no metallic sheen. This is a beautiful ink that is opaque and distinctly golden from every angle. I haven't dripped or run it yet. This is a permanent ink but please remember to shake it well before each use. Goes well with Speedball Assorted Hunt Artists No. 99 and no. 101 Nib Sets of 2. and a Speedball Oblique Pen

True gold colour, opaque on light and dark backgrounds, waterproof

Again Dr. Ph Martin's does not disappoint! I've been using this mascara for about a year and now I'm a little over halfway through the bottle. The ink is golden in color, has a slightly raised texture when dry, and contains no shiny particles that make many gold inks look fake. I use these inks for both coloring and calligraphy (the main reason I use them) and was impressed by how smoothly they write with large and small nibs on both smooth and textured paper.
